Output 82dfeb23a3d9b8329025f2e370ff30d76c2d8a00bfaf0605407c5d68e2f0a45a:13

value
500344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b17eef504d99a605f14de9be7a43eb61799096ac OP_EQUAL
address
3HsXb5oSAjkPV1jxyFgqhsuVCSPzjwKYxE
transaction
82dfeb23a3d9b8329025f2e370ff30d76c2d8a00bfaf0605407c5d68e2f0a45a
spent
false

3 Sat Ranges